Elevated Meal Planning for Body + Brain Do you ever feel like mealtime sneaks up on you like a ninja, especially after a long day of juggling work and family? You open the fridge and expect inspiration to leap out at you. (Spoiler: it doesn’t.) I knew I wanted to eat to feel better, not just full. So, here was the prompt I used: “Build a paleo gluten-free weekly meal plan with high protein, blood sugar stable dinners for a family of four. Include make-ahead tips, freezer-friendly swaps, and a grocery list by aisle, and make sure that it’s not too spicy, because my kids don’t like spicy.” The result? A family-friendly, hormone-supporting plan that made evenings smoother and more nourishing. It even added in freezer nights and leftover days to reduce food waste! We went back and forth like a true sous-chef tag team, refining the plan until it felt aligned. I clarified that I wanted make-ahead options, minimal weeknight prep, and ingredients I already had on hand. Here’s what I’d tell you if we were voice memo-ing about this: Your dinner doesn’t have to be fancy to be functional. Fuel your brain, feed your babies, and skip the 5PM panic stare into the fridge abyss. 2. The Minimalist Fitness Reset If you’re someone who also struggles to squeeze in workouts that actually feel good (not punishing) this one’s for you. I came to ChatGPT with a confession: “I’ve got 45 minutes a day, some resistance bands, and a treadmill. I want movement that matches my cycle and doesn’t leave me fried.” Together we pieced together something beautiful. I asked for flexibility based on my energy levels throughout my cycle and included little mindset check-ins. Then I said, “Can you give me a short warm-up before each workout, and maybe something reflective at the end so it feels like a ritual?” ChatGPT was basically like, “Say less, coach!” Here’s the exact prompt I used to create my custom exercise plan with AI: “Create a 4-week low impact fitness program for me syncing to my cycle using walking on the treadmill, Pilates and weight training. Include warmups and make sure that there’s enough rest to not spike my cortisol too much.” In return, it gave me a full-body plan split into follicular, ovulation, luteal, and menstrual phases. Each phase had energy-appropriate movement and reflections like, “What does my body need today?” It felt less like a workout calendar and more like a self-care blueprint. Real Talk: If your workout feels like punishment, your body’s probably calling for a pep talk, not a push. Let movement meet your mood. 3. Holistic Health Habits That Actually Stick If you’ve ever promised yourself you’d start waking up at 5AM, oil pulling, dry brushing, meditating, and journaling… and then do none of those things, welcome to the club . I told ChatGPT, “I want 3 small but powerful wellness habits that don’t feel like a second job.” It gave me some great starting points, then I asked, “Okay, but can you divide them by time of day and make them make sense for a mom who’s running a business?” The next version was way more doable. Think less goop-y, more grounded. Ready to get your holistic health game on with me? Here’s the prompt I used: “List 3 powerful wellness habits for better sleep, digestion, and mental clarity. Break them into morning, midday, and evening routines for a busy mom. Keep it under five minutes.” Now, I’m doing breathwork at breakfast, taking a lunchtime mobility break, and a post-work digital detox ritual… Things I can actually do because they’re simple, intentional, and don’t require a Himalayan salt lamp. Friendly reminder from your friend Jenna: You don’t need a 17-step morning routine. Sometimes the best wellness habit is drinking water before coffee and not doomscrolling before 8AM! 4. Email Voice Makeovers for the People Pleasers Have you ever drafted an email, reread it six times, and still felt like you’re coming off too harsh… Or worse, like you’re apologizing for existing? Same. So I dropped a message into ChatGPT and said, “Here’s what I’m trying to say. Help me say it clearly, kindly, and confidently.” It came back with a few options: one that was short and punchy, one that was warm and a little playful, and one that had a “let’s still be besties but I’m saying no” vibe. I picked the one that matched my energy that day, then asked, “Can you soften the CTA just a bit?” Nailed it! Next time you’re struggling to say what you mean in an email, use this ChatGPT prompt: “Rewrite this email to feel clear, confident, and calm. Make sure it feels personable but very clear in [insert topic or decision].” Before you know it, you’ll have an email that felt like me on my best communication day: not rushed, not overly apologetic, and actually effective. Goal Diggers, think of this as your inbox glow-up… because being kind doesn’t mean being unclear! 5.
